Is Newington, CT Safe from Theft?

The C- grade means the rate of theft is slightly higher than the average US city. Newington is in the 31st percentile for safety, meaning 69% of cities are safer and 31% of cities are more dangerous. This analysis applies to Newington's proper boundaries only. See the table on nearby places below for nearby cities.

The rate of theft in Newington is 12.37 per 1,000 residents during a standard year. People who live in Newington generally consider the northeast part of the city to be the safest.

Your chance of being a victim of theft in Newington may be as high as 1 in 63 in the northwest neighborhoods, or as low as 1 in 106 in the northeast part of the city.

By a simple count ignoring population, more theft occurs in the southwest parts of Newington, CT: about 57 per year. The central part of Newington has fewer cases of theft with only 23 in a typical year.

How Newington's Theft Rate Compares

The chart below compares the theft rate in Newington to the Connecticut state average and the national average. All rates are the number of crimes per 1,000 residents in a standard year.

Newington, CT: 12.37
Connecticut: 11.78
USA: 13.00

Considering only the theft rate, Newington is as safe as the Connecticut state average and as safe as the national average.

The Cost of Theft in Newington, CT

Theft is projected to cost the residents of Newington about $1,956,791 in 2025, or roughly $64 per resident. This is part of Newington's overall Cost of Crime™. See the full cost-of-crime breakdown for Newington, including every crime type and how Newington compares to other cities.

Interpreting the Theft Map

Remember that theft rates are measured per resident. Places with heavy daytime traffic, like shopping districts, airports, and parks, can look more dangerous than they are for the people who live there. See a full guide to reading Newington's crime maps on the Newington overall crime page.
